# Build Provenance — ShrinkRay CLI

Welcome aboard. Every ShrinkRay release (our batch image resizer) is built in a sealed runner at Calloway Forge, from a tagged commit only. The manifest records compiler version, dependency hashes, and the signing key fingerprint. Before trusting any binary, match its manifest against the value printed below.

session token of tajef-bageg = htk21_5d90d574934f3ccae6437

/*
 * Log sampling rate for the Chattermill notification relay.
 * This service emits one log line per delivery attempt, which
 * overwhelms shared sinks at peak volume. Plugin authors should
 * not log per-attempt themselves; rely on this sampled stream
 * instead. A rate of 0.05 keeps roughly one in twenty lines,
 * enough for trend analysis without flooding storage. Raising it
 * requires sign-off from the platform team. The sampled lines
 * carry the build token shown directly below.
 */

session token of hawif-yagep = htk14_cdc8f861ea8d22

Hey — handing off the Cartwheel driver-assignment heuristic. The scoring change in my open PR weights pickup proximity higher during peak hours; the old distance-only logic is still behind a flag. Tests pass, but eyeball the tie-breaking logic, it's fiddly. Design notes and the benchmark results are on the page below.

operations page: https://jenkins.zemvarcloud.local/job/merge_requests/repo/build/73930b4b30f0a8ed